Mothers Union: Reform could undermine marriage

Wednesday, 31 May 2006 14:22
The Mothers' Union (MU) has said marriage will be undermined, if today’s proposals to give greater rights to unmarried couples are implemented.

The Law Commission is beginning a review into legal reform to bring cohabiting couples’ rights in line with those of married couples.

But an MU spokeswoman said that although any initiative to strengthen family life and protect children was welcome, stable marriages must be preserved.

The union works to support marriage through preparation and support, and she urged the government to create a "climate of support" for both individual couples and the institution itself.

Chief executive Reg Bailey said: “There is an overwhelming body of evidence from research that marriage provides the best basis for raising a stable family.

“That’s why it is so disappointing to see yet another government initiative that seems to undermine one of the best building blocks of strong communities.”
